Construction Salaries in Den Haag, Netherlands

Salaries vary by company, region and experience. All amounts are gross (before tax). Holiday allowance (8%) is added on top.

In Den Haag, the entry-level salary for a concrete worker starts around the Dutch minimum wage of €14.71 per hour, with many positions offering slightly above this rate based on experience and specific project requirements. Pay can increase with additional certifications, overtime hours, or working on premium projects. Skilled workers with relevant qualifications may earn up to €16-€18 per hour, especially if working night shifts or on complex construction sites.

Besides salary, construction workers benefit from mandatory holiday allowances of 8%, pension contributions, travel expense reimbursements, and access to ongoing training programs. These benefits provide long-term security and support career development, making construction in Den Haag a rewarding employment choice with comprehensive support systems.

Working in Construction

Construction workers in Den Haag typically follow a standard work schedule of 37.5 to 40 hours per week, often with shifts that allow for planned days off. Daily tasks for a concrete worker include mixing, pouring, and finishing concrete for various structural elements, ensuring quality and safety standards are met. The work often takes place outdoors or in construction sites with varying weather conditions, requiring flexibility and physical endurance.

Dutch labor laws protect workers' rights, including fair pay, safe working environments, and holiday entitlement. Most construction projects are covered by collective bargaining agreements (CAO) that set minimum standards for wages, overtime pay, and safety regulations. Overtime is compensated, and safety gear such as helmets, gloves, and harnesses are mandatory to prevent accidents during work.

Concrete Worker Career Path

Starting as an entry-level concrete worker in Den Haag provides a solid foundation for career advancement. With experience, workers can progress to supervisory roles such as site supervisor or team leader, overseeing other construction staff and coordinating projects. Developing skills in project planning, safety management, and specialized concrete techniques opens further opportunities.

Advanced roles include specialization in areas such as structural concrete, precast elements, or concrete restoration. Acquiring certifications like VCA (Safety, Health, Environment certificate) or specialized technical trainings can significantly boost promotion chances, leading to higher wages and more complex project involvement in the Dutch construction industry.
